It's Japanese.
It means, "You truly are an idiot."
Anata - you
Hontou ni - truly
baka - idiot
"desu" is the verb "to be" or in this sentence "are"
"ne" means that they believe you will agree, or they are agreeing with you, if you called yourself an idiot first.
